Anita Shepherd, founder and CEO of Anita's Yogurt, is making arepas three different ways. All of them are crispy on the outside, pillowy-soft on the inside, plant-based (although you can sub in dairy if you prefer), and oh-so-delicious. Her vegan version of the Colombian classic has a plant-based butter in the dough, the Venezuelan is filled with a jackfruit ropa vieja, and the New York-style is made with yellow corn and stuffed with cheese. Anita Shepherd’s Vegan Arepas
PREP TIME: 15 minutes
COOK TIME: 15 minutes
MAKES: 3
INGREDIENTS
1 cup masa harina precocida (precooked variety)
1 cup hot water
1/4 cup salted cultured butter (plant-based or dairy), softened
1/2 teaspoon sea salt
